Lucía Crivelli is a renowned neuropsychologist and columnist for Infobae, known for her insights on the science of happiness and well-being. She emphasizes the role of neurotransmitters, life purpose, and daily habits in fostering emotional health. Crivelli advocates for practical approaches to enhancing happiness, suggesting that simple actions like enjoying chocolate, receiving sunlight, having pets, and exercising can activate neurobiological systems of reward and pleasure. Her work contributes to a modern understanding of happiness, highlighting that it is not merely an outcome but can be cultivated through consistent and intentional practices.
